Direct answer
A winning PR proposal format shifts the focus from the agency's history to the client's business objectives. It should begin with a deep dive into the current market perception, followed by a strategic roadmap that outlines specific goals, target audiences, and a tactical execution plan. The core of the proposal is the 'Proof of Concept' section, where previous wins are used as evidence that the proposed strategy will work for this specific client.

Practical guide
Adopting a professional PR proposal format is about more than just aesthetics; it is about demonstrating a strategic mindset. Clients are not buying press releases; they are buying a specific outcome, such as market authority or crisis mitigation. A structured format allows you to lead with the solution, proving that you understand the client's unique challenges before you ever mention your agency's pricing or history.
When building your response, the transition from the situation audit to the tactical plan is critical. This is where many agencies fail by offering a 'menu' of services rather than a tailored strategy. A high-quality PR proposal format links every tactic—whether it is a media tour or a thought-leadership series—directly back to a business objective identified in the audit phase, making the investment feel logical and necessary.
Finally, the review process is where the win is secured. PR is a high-stakes communication business, so any typo or generic statement in your proposal suggests a lack of attention to detail. Using a structured workbench to track compliance and verify that every claim is backed by a source document ensures that your final submission is polished, accurate, and aligned with the client's expectations.
